Hur man konverterar RTF till PPTX med GroupDocs.Conversion för .NET: En steg-för-steg-guide
Introduktion
Letar du efter ett effektivt sätt att konvertera RTF-dokument till PowerPoint-presentationer? Med GroupDocs.Conversion för .NET är denna uppgift enkel och okomplicerad. Detta kraftfulla bibliotek möjliggör sömlös integration i dina .NET-applikationer, vilket möjliggör enkel omvandling av RTF-filer till PPTX-format.
I den här guiden guidar vi dig genom processen att använda GroupDocs.Conversion för .NET för att effektivt konvertera RTF-dokument till PowerPoint-presentationer. Du lär dig hur du konfigurerar din miljö, implementerar konverteringsprocessen och utforskar praktiska tillämpningar.
Vad du kommer att lära dig:
- Så här installerar och konfigurerar du GroupDocs.Conversion i ditt .NET-projekt
- En steg-för-steg-guide för att konvertera RTF-filer till PPTX-format
- Viktiga konfigurationsalternativ för att anpassa konverteringsprocessen
- Praktiska användningsfall och integrationsmöjligheter
Låt oss börja med att granska förutsättningarna.
Förkunskapskrav
För att följa den här handledningen, se till att du har:
- Bibliotek och beroenden: GroupDocs.Conversion version 25.3.0 är installerad i ditt projekt.
- Miljöinställningar: En .NET-utvecklingsmiljö som Visual Studio.
- Kunskapsbas: Grundläggande kunskaper i C#-programmering och filkonvertering.
Konfigurera GroupDocs.Conversion för .NET
Installation
Börja med att installera det nödvändiga paketet med antingen NuGet Package Manager-konsolen eller .NET CLI:
NuGet-pakethanterarkonsolen
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I
dotnet add package GroupDocs.Conversion --version 25.3.0
Licensförvärv
GroupDocs erbjuder en gratis provperiod för att testa sina API-funktioner. För kontinuerlig användning kan du köpa en licens eller skaffa en tillfällig licens för utvärderingsändamål.
Grundläggande initialisering och installation
När den är installerad, initiera konverteraren i ditt .NET-projekt med denna C#-kodavsnitt:
using GroupDocs.Conversion;
string documentPath = "YOUR_DOCUMENT_DIRECTORY/sample.rtf"; // Sökväg till din RTF-fil
var converter = new Converter(documentPath);
Den här konfigurationen förbereder dig för konverteringsprocessen.
Implementeringsguide
Konvertera RTF till PPTX
Översikt
Den här funktionen låter dig konvertera ett RTF-dokument till en PowerPoint-presentation (PPTX) med GroupDocs.Conversion, vilket gör den idealisk för att skapa visuellt tilltalande presentationer från textdokument.
Implementeringssteg
Steg 1: Definiera filsökvägar och namn
Ange sökvägarna och namnen på din RTF-fil och PPTX-fil:
string documentPath =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.rtf");
string outputFolder = Path.Combine("YOUR_OUTPUT_DIRECTORY");
string outputFile = Path.Combine(outputFolder, "rtf-converted-to.pptx");
Steg 2: Ladda RTF-filen
Använd Converter
klass för att ladda din RTF-fil:
using (var converter = new Converter(documentPath))
{
// Konverteringsprocessen kommer att inledas här
}
Detta säkerställer att ditt dokument är klart för konvertering.
Steg 3: Initiera presentationskonverteringsalternativ
Konfigurera konverteringsalternativen med hjälp av PresentationConvertOptions
:
var options = new PresentationConvertOptions();
Med dessa alternativ kan du anpassa hur RTF-innehållet visas i PPTX-formatet.
Steg 4: Utför konvertering
Slutligen, konvertera och spara ditt dokument:
csv converter.Convert(outputFile, options);
Det här steget utför den faktiska konverteringen och lagrar resultatet på din angivna utdataplats.
Felsökningstips
- Vanligt problem: Se till att sökvägarna är korrekt definierade för att undvika felmeddelanden om att filen inte hittades.
- Lösning: Dubbelkolla katalognamnen och verifiera filbehörigheterna.
Praktiska tillämpningar
Användningsfall för RTF till PPTX-konvertering
- Affärsrapportering: Konvertera detaljerade textrapporter till presentationsbilder för möten.
- Utbildningsmaterial: Förvandla föreläsningsanteckningar till interaktiva presentationer.
- Marknadsföringskampanjer: Skapa engagerande bilder från textinnehåll för reklamevenemang.
- Dokumentarkivering: Bevara dokumentformateringen vid konvertering till ett mer mångsidigt format.
- Samarbetsprojekt: Underlätta teamsamarbete genom att dela information i PowerPoint-format.
Integrationsmöjligheter
GroupDocs.Conversion kan integreras med andra .NET-ramverk och system, vilket förbättrar dess användbarhet över plattformar som ASP.NET för webbapplikationer eller Windows Forms för skrivbordsprogram.
Prestandaöverväganden
Optimera konverteringseffektivitet
- Resurshantering: Övervaka minnesanvändningen under konvertering för att förhindra flaskhalsar.
- Batchbearbetning: Konvertera flera filer i omgångar för att förbättra dataflödet.
- Bästa praxis: Uppdatera regelbundet biblioteket och optimera dina .NET-applikationsinställningar för maximal prestanda.
Slutsats
I den här guiden har vi utforskat hur man implementerar RTF- till PPTX-konverteringar med GroupDocs.Conversion för .NET. Genom att följa dessa steg kan du förbättra dokumenthanteringen i dina applikationer.
Nästa steg
Försök att implementera den här lösningen i dina projekt och utforska andra konverteringsfunktioner som erbjuds av GroupDocs.Conversion. Överväg att anpassa konverteringsprocessen ytterligare för att passa specifika behov.
Redo att börja konvertera? Läs mer om resurserna nedan för mer insikt och stöd.
FAQ-sektion
F1: Vilken .NET-version krävs minst för GroupDocs.Conversion?
- A1: Du behöver minst .NET Framework 4.0 eller senare.
F2: Kan jag konvertera RTF-filer med inbäddade bilder?
- A2: Ja, bilder kommer att inkluderas i PPTX-konverteringen.
F3: Hur hanterar jag stora filer under konvertering?
- A3: Optimera din applikations prestanda och överväg att öka systemresurserna om det behövs.
F4: Finns det några begränsningar för filstorleken med GroupDocs.Conversion?
- A4: Även om det generellt sett är tillmötesgående kan mycket stora filer kräva ytterligare strategier för minneshantering.
F5: Kan jag anpassa bildlayouten under konverteringen?
- A5: Ja, du kan använda
PresentationConvertOptions
för att justera inställningar som bildstorlek och layoutinställningar.
Resurser
- Dokumentation: GroupDocs.Conversion .NET-dokumentation
- API-referens: GroupDocs API-referens
- Ladda ner: Hämta GroupDocs.Conversion för .NET
- Köpa: Köp GroupDocs-licens
- Gratis provperiod: Gratis testversion av GroupDocs nedladdning
- Tillfällig licens: Begär en tillfällig licens
- Stöd: Gå med i forumet